The Intel P8742AH is an 8-bit single-chip microcomputer. It is part of the MCS-48 family and is designed for a wide range of control applications. It integrates a CPU, RAM, ROM/EPROM, I/O ports, and a timer/counter on a single chip.
Applications
- Keyboard controllers
- Appliance control (e.g., washing machines, microwave ovens)
- Industrial control systems
- Remote control systems
- Simple embedded systems
Features
- 8-bit CPU
- 128 bytes of RAM
- 2048 bytes of EPROM (Erasable Programmable Read-Only Memory)
- 27 I/O lines
- 8-bit timer/counter
- Single-level interrupt
- On-chip oscillator

Additional Details
The P8742AH operates on a 5V power supply. It is available in a 40-pin DIP (Dual In-line Package). Programming the EPROM requires a dedicated EPROM programmer.
